Output dd2508d4bfd624ed305f2b9c499ccae2c0611b4f9800f1fc8522cab689dbaf25:0

value
58996030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cf872f39c389008761686f94f82a531cd5d4da4 OP_EQUAL
address
3D5oLsXTywjWZvHHCppnxZpJF9kz8EHW7K
transaction
dd2508d4bfd624ed305f2b9c499ccae2c0611b4f9800f1fc8522cab689dbaf25
spent
true